Zentiva, a generic platform of Sanofi, is the third largest and fastest growing generics company in Europe. Its history dates back to the 15th century and it has a splendid reputation in the market for its generic products.
Zentiva has four key production plants in Central and Eastern Europe, enabling it to manufacture and distribute products across all its markets quickly and efficiently. Zentiva maintains the highest product quality and security standards across their manufacturing and supply lines. Their modern state-of-the-art facilities employ almost 3,000 people and produce an annual output of 440 million units, making Zentiva one of the largest producers of pharmaceuticals, by volume, in Europe.
Zentiva provides affordable and reliable medicines to patients and healthcare providers throughout Europe.
Zentiva is a member of the Sanofi Group.
